It is possible but you can not do it "in game". You can not simply edit the league database and insert a new row, i think that then structure is changed and the AI can not read it. IMO the only way is to create a new database which has a new structur and can pass all relveant data to the league database to play a game. You need a new AI which can use the information of the new database. This part of the game must be new written.
